Survodutide
Pipeline · Glucagon and GLP-1 receptor dual agonist
Last updated 2026-05-28Survodutide is an experimental drug that works by activating two different receptors in the body: one that responds to glucagon (a hormone that helps control blood sugar) and another that responds to GLP-1 (a hormone that slows digestion and reduces appetite). It is being developed as a potential treatment for obesity and related conditions, but it is not yet approved for any use.
